鸿蒙OS:华为万物互联操作系统的演进之路与核心技术解析261


“华为鸿蒙系统用了几年了?”这个问题看似简单,其背后却承载着一个中国科技巨头在全球复杂地缘政治和技术竞争格局下,谋求生存、突破与创新的宏大叙事。作为一名操作系统专家,我认为鸿蒙(HarmonyOS)的诞生与发展,不仅仅是技术层面的迭代,更是一场关于生态构建、技术自主和未来智能生活愿景的深刻探索。从首次亮相至今,鸿蒙系统已走过数个年头,其历程充满了挑战、争议与里程碑式的突破。

鸿蒙的起源与战略必要性:危局中的破局者

要理解鸿蒙系统的“年龄”,首先要回溯到其诞生的背景——2019年5月,美国对华为施加的制裁,切断了华为对谷歌GMS(Google Mobile Services)的访问权限,这对于高度依赖安卓生态的华为手机业务无疑是致命一击。此时,华为多年准备的“备胎计划”——鸿蒙操作系统,从幕后走向了台前。

华为推出鸿蒙的战略必要性显而易见:
技术自主与供应链安全:摆脱对单一操作系统(安卓)的过度依赖,提升核心技术自主可控能力,确保企业在极端情况下的生存与发展。
构建万物互联生态:华为的愿景并非仅仅是为手机打造一个替代系统,而是面向未来“万物互联”时代,构建一个能够打通手机、平板、智能穿戴、智能家居、智能汽车等所有设备的统一操作系统,实现无缝协同的智慧生活体验。
创新差异化竞争:在移动互联网日益饱和的背景下,通过分布式技术和全场景协同能力,为用户提供有别于传统智能手机的新一代交互体验,开辟新的增长空间。

因此,鸿蒙从一开始就肩负着超越传统手机操作系统的使命,其目标是创建一个基于同一套语言、同一套架构的分布式操作系统,这决定了其开发周期与复杂性远超常规。

鸿蒙系统核心发展历程与版本迭代

根据其正式发布和大规模商用的时间点,我们可以清晰地勾勒出鸿蒙系统的发展轨迹:
2019年8月9日:鸿蒙OS 1.0正式发布。在华为开发者大会上首次亮相,最初应用于荣耀智慧屏产品。这个阶段的鸿蒙主要面向物联网设备,展示了其分布式能力和微内核架构雏形,但尚未登陆手机。可以说,这是鸿蒙的“元年”,从技术宣布到产品落地,它已经“用了”了。
2020年9月10日:鸿蒙OS 2.0发布。华为进一步开放了鸿蒙系统,支持智能手机、平板、智能穿戴等更多设备。同时,发布了针对开发者的Beta版本,以及鸿蒙分布式软总线、分布式数据管理、分布式安全等核心技术。这是鸿蒙系统向手机和平板等核心智能设备迈出的关键一步,标志着其生态拓展的开始。
2021年6月2日:鸿蒙OS 2.0正式面向华为手机大规模推送。这是鸿蒙系统发展史上的里程碑时刻,标志着它真正开始在消费者最熟悉的智能手机上“大放异彩”。在这一年里,数亿设备升级至鸿蒙系统,构建起庞大的用户基础。需要指出的是,为了兼容安卓生态和快速过渡,2.0及后续版本在底层仍兼容AOSP(Android Open Source Project)代码,并通过方舟编译器、分布式技术等实现了鸿蒙特性。
2022年7月27日:鸿蒙OS 3.0发布。此版本进一步强化了分布式能力,提升了性能、隐私安全和用户体验。在超级终端的互联互通、原子化服务的便捷性、智慧出行等方面都有显著升级。系统流畅度、稳定性及能效表现也得到优化。
2023年8月4日:鸿蒙OS 4.0发布。聚焦个性化体验、流畅性能、全场景智慧以及隐私安全,引入了全新的动效、主题和卡片设计,AI能力深度整合,尤其是盘古大模型的能力开始融入系统,提供更智能的场景识别和服务推荐。此外,隐私安全方面也进一步提升。
展望未来:HarmonyOS NEXT。华为已多次预告“纯血鸿蒙”——HarmonyOS NEXT的到来。这意味着鸿蒙系统将彻底剥离AOSP代码,构建完全自主的内核和应用生态,不再兼容安卓应用,所有应用需基于鸿蒙内核进行原生开发。这将是鸿蒙系统走向独立自主的终极目标,也是对其技术和生态建设能力的终极考验。目前,开发者预览版已面向部分开发者开放,预计在2024年会有更广泛的推广。

综合来看,从2019年8月首次发布算起,到2024年,鸿蒙系统已经“用了”超过四年半的时间。而从其大规模应用于手机并真正进入消费者视野的2021年6月算起,也已经超过两年半。在这段不长不短的时间里,鸿蒙从一个“备胎”系统,成长为数亿设备的操作系统,其发展速度和体量都令人瞩目。

鸿蒙系统的技术核心与专业解读

作为一款面向未来的操作系统,鸿蒙的核心技术亮点在于其分布式能力、灵活的内核架构和构建全场景智慧生态的理念。
分布式架构:万物互联的基石

鸿蒙最核心的特性是其“分布式架构”。它允许不同设备上的硬件资源(如屏幕、摄像头、麦克风、扬声器、算力)被抽象化并虚拟化为一个“超级终端”,实现资源共享和协同工作。这背后依赖的关键技术包括:
软总线(Soft Bus):这是分布式架构的神经系统,负责设备的发现、连接、组网和数据传输。它能够实现设备之间的高速、低延迟、高可靠的连接,无论设备是通过蓝牙、Wi-Fi Direct还是有线连接,都能被统一纳管。
分布式数据管理:在不同设备间实现数据的无缝流转、同步和统一存储,用户可以在任何设备上访问和修改相同的数据,无需手动传输。
分布式任务调度:应用的不同部分可以运行在不同的设备上,例如,手机作为主控设备,将计算密集型任务卸载到平板或PC上处理,再将结果返回手机。这使得应用的体验不再受限于单一设备的性能。
原子化服务(Atomic Services):这是鸿蒙应用形态的创新。它将应用服务拆解成一个个小的、独立的、可流转的功能模块,用户无需下载安装整个App,即可在需要时调用这些服务,并通过“服务流转”在不同设备间无缝切换。


内核架构的演进与平衡:从微内核到混合内核

早期鸿蒙宣传其采用“微内核”设计,这在操作系统领域是前沿且具有挑战性的。微内核的优势在于模块化、高安全性、高可靠性,且易于扩展。然而,纯粹的微内核在性能上往往不如宏内核。鸿蒙的实际实现,尤其是在早期为兼容安卓生态的阶段,采取了更为务实和灵活的策略:
多内核协同:鸿蒙并非单一的微内核系统。对于资源受限的IoT设备,可能使用轻量级的LiteOS内核;对于高性能的智能手机和平板,则在兼容AOSP的阶段,利用了Linux内核的成熟生态和性能。OpenHarmony作为鸿蒙的开源版本,其设计理念是支持多内核,根据设备资源和场景需求选择最合适的内核,并通过统一的OS抽象层向上提供服务。这是一种务实的“混合内核”策略,旨在兼顾性能、兼容性和安全性。
模块化设计:无论底层使用何种内核,鸿蒙都致力于实现操作系统的模块化。通过“设备抽象层”和“服务抽象层”,将底层硬件差异屏蔽,向上层应用提供统一的API接口。这使得开发者可以基于统一的框架开发应用,而无需关心底层设备的多样性。


全场景智慧体验与开发生态

鸿蒙OS致力于构建一个超越传统App的“全场景智慧生活”体验。这体现在:
超级终端:用户可以自由组合不同设备,形成一个强大的协同工作单元,例如手机与智慧屏联动进行视频通话,或手机与平板无缝接力文档编辑。
智慧助手今天:聚合了多种服务卡片和智慧建议,提供千人千面的个性化服务。
开发工具:华为提供了DevEco Studio作为一体化开发环境,支持多语言开发(Java、JS、C/C++),并通过方舟编译器和ArkUI框架,实现应用的一次开发、多端部署,大大降低了开发者的适配成本。
AI能力:鸿蒙4.0开始深度融合盘古大模型,在语音识别、图像处理、智能推荐、自然语言理解等方面为系统注入更强的AI能力,提升用户体验的智能化水平。



鸿蒙面临的挑战与战略意义

尽管鸿蒙取得了显著进展,但其前行的道路上仍面临诸多挑战:
生态建设的“鸡生蛋,蛋生鸡”难题:一个成功的操作系统需要庞大的开发者和应用生态。鸿蒙需要吸引足够的开发者为原生系统开发应用,而开发者则需要看到足够多的用户基数。尤其是HarmonyOS NEXT彻底脱离AOSP后,这将是最大的考验。
国际化推广与市场份额:受制裁影响,华为在全球市场尤其是海外市场推广鸿蒙面临巨大阻力。缺乏谷歌GMS生态的支持,对海外用户吸引力有限。
用户认知与品牌忠诚度:许多用户对鸿蒙的认知仍停留在“安卓换皮”阶段。如何持续通过技术创新和优质体验,建立用户对鸿蒙的独立品牌认知和忠诚度,是长期任务。
持续的技术投入与创新:操作系统是高度复杂且需要持续投入的领域。要与iOS和Android两大巨头竞争,鸿蒙需要不断在性能、安全、AI集成和用户体验上保持领先。

然而,鸿蒙的战略意义已远超华为一家企业:
中国科技自主的标志:鸿蒙系统已成为中国在核心技术领域寻求突破和自主可控的象征。其成功与否,关系到国家在全球科技竞争中的地位。
探索未来操作系统范式:鸿蒙的分布式能力为未来的物联网和全场景智能设备交互提供了新的思路,它代表了一种可能的未来操作系统形态。
推动产业变革:鸿蒙的出现促使其他厂商和开发者重新思考操作系统的开放性、兼容性以及设备协同的潜力,对整个行业产生积极的推动作用。

结论

“华为鸿蒙系统用了几年了?”这个简单的问题,引出了一个复杂而深刻的故事。从2019年8月至今,鸿蒙系统已走过近五年光景,从一个备胎计划成长为一个承载数亿设备、面向万物互联的操作系统。它不仅是华为在全球变局下的战略突围,更是中国乃至全球科技界在操作系统领域进行的一次大胆探索。

鸿蒙的发展历程是技术与战略、挑战与机遇交织的画卷。它在底层技术上不断演进,通过分布式架构实现了设备间的无缝协同;在生态建设上则步履维艰,但又矢志不渝地追求原生自主。HarmonyOS NEXT的推出,将是鸿蒙走向成熟和独立的标志性一步,它将决定鸿蒙能否真正构建起一个全新的、完全自主的数字生态。

作为操作系统专家,我认为鸿蒙的价值远不止于一款手机操作系统,它代表着对未来智能生活方式的畅想,以及在复杂多变的世界中寻求技术主权和创新能力的坚定信念。其未来的发展,无疑将继续牵动全球科技界的目光。

2025-10-21


上一篇:揭秘iOS的Unix基因:深入解析苹果移动操作系统的核心架构与传承

下一篇:iOS系统性能优化专家指南:告别卡顿,畅享极速体验的深度解析

新文章
华为Mate 9并非鸿蒙:从Android到分布式OS的华为操作系统演进之路
华为Mate 9并非鸿蒙:从Android到分布式OS的华为操作系统演进之路
4分钟前
Windows更新后黑屏:操作系统专家深度解析与终极解决方案
Windows更新后黑屏:操作系统专家深度解析与终极解决方案
10分钟前
深入探究:iOS操作系统的前世今生与核心技术起源
深入探究:iOS操作系统的前世今生与核心技术起源
13分钟前
iOS系统中的个性化数字身份:动漫头像背后的操作系统技术与用户体验深度解析
iOS系统中的个性化数字身份:动漫头像背后的操作系统技术与用户体验深度解析
19分钟前
iOS桌面美学深度解析:从系统架构到用户体验的专业洞察与技术实现
iOS桌面美学深度解析:从系统架构到用户体验的专业洞察与技术实现
23分钟前
iOS系统与ShadowsocksR:从核心架构到网络安全与隐私策略的深度解析
iOS系统与ShadowsocksR:从核心架构到网络安全与隐私策略的深度解析
28分钟前
Windows 运行 iOS 系统:技术深度解析、可行性与替代方案
Windows 运行 iOS 系统:技术深度解析、可行性与替代方案
44分钟前
鸿蒙OS:从微内核到全场景智慧生态的操作系统演进
鸿蒙OS:从微内核到全场景智慧生态的操作系统演进
48分钟前
深入解析 rekordbox iOS 版:移动DJ应用如何驾驭Apple操作系统核心技术
深入解析 rekordbox iOS 版:移动DJ应用如何驾驭Apple操作系统核心技术
52分钟前
Linux系统安装疑难杂症:从准备到启动的全方位专业排障指南
Linux系统安装疑难杂症:从准备到启动的全方位专业排障指南
56分钟前
热门文章
iOS 系统的局限性
iOS 系统的局限性
12-24 19:45
Linux USB 设备文件系统
Linux USB 设备文件系统
11-19 00:26
Mac OS 9:革命性操作系统的深度剖析
Mac OS 9:革命性操作系统的深度剖析
11-05 18:10
华为鸿蒙操作系统:业界领先的分布式操作系统
华为鸿蒙操作系统:业界领先的分布式操作系统
11-06 11:48
**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**
**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**
10-29 23:20
macOS 直接安装新系统,保留原有数据
macOS 直接安装新系统,保留原有数据
12-08 09:14
Windows系统精简指南:优化性能和提高效率
Windows系统精简指南:优化性能和提高效率
12-07 05:07
macOS 系统语言更改指南 [专家详解]
macOS 系统语言更改指南 [专家详解]
11-04 06:28
iOS 操作系统:移动领域的先驱
iOS 操作系统:移动领域的先驱
10-18 12:37
华为鸿蒙系统:全面赋能多场景智慧体验
华为鸿蒙系统:全面赋能多场景智慧体验
10-17 22:49